Changing the Administrator Password

The default password for the router’s Web Configuration Manager is password. Change this
password to a more secure password.

From the Main Menu of the browser interface, under the Maintenance heading, select Set
Password to bring up the menu shown below.

To change the password:

1. First enter the old password

2. Enter the new password twice.

3. Click Apply to save your changes.

Note: Before changing the router password, use the router backup utility to save your

configuration settings. If after changing the password, you forget the new password
you assigned, you will have to reset the router back to the factory defaults to be
able to log in using the default password of password. This means you will have to
restore all the router configuration settings. If you ever have to reset the router back
to the factory defaults, you can restore your settings from the backup.

Tip: After changing the password, it is a good idea to create a new backup file so that

it includes the new password (see

“Restoring and Backing Up the

Configuration” on page 4-10

for details).
